Summary
The Beacon praised the Community Players’ December 3 A Christmas Carol at Holy Cross Hall as a community-wide production, emphasizing its 24 players, more than 40 parts, staging, direction, and cast.
Evidence limits
This is a review and printed roster, not an independent attendance, ticket, or production archive.
